Dear Prospective Families
Carrying on the traditions from our founders, the Dominican Sisters of San Rafael, St. John Vianney School has educated thousands of young minds for the past five decades. We are a TK- 8th grade co-educational Catholic elementary and junior high school located in Rancho Cordova, California. Accredited by the Western Catholic Educational Association and the Western Association of Schools and Colleges, St. John Vianney School provides a quality education which stresses traditional Catholic values and practices. We maintain high academic standards, serve the community and encourage respect for all people.
The goal of St. John Vianney School is to educate the whole child, keeping an appropriate balance of spiritual, intellectual, cultural, social, emotional, and physical development. We recognize that parents are the primary educators of their children and that the function of the school is to extend and support this process. It is our aim to implement a program that will recognize and address the individual needs and dignity of each child because all are children of God
The core curriculum is academically challenging and is designed to help students prepare for rigorous high school pursuits. Beyond the classroom, St. John Vianney students are offered many co-curricular and extra-curricular activities, including athletics, academic competitions, art docent program, choir, and countless special events occurring throughout the year.
